Tunnel Boring Machine Excavation

The South Englewood Flood Reduction Project is progressing with the use of advanced tunneling technology. The project aims to mitigate flood risks in the area while minimizing disruptions to residents.
Englewood Public Works is working with American Civil Constructors (ACC) and subcontractor Northstar to employ a Tunnel Boring Machine (TBM) designed to excavate underground to accommodate the new pipe. The tunneling will cover approximately 1,600 feet between the new detention pond and Rotolo Park. The tunnel is constructed using the two pass method, which involves installing sections of the tunnel in 4-5' increments as the TBM makes its first pass through the future tunnel location, followed by pipe sections on its second pass therefore creating the completed tunnel.
Utilizing the TBM was chosen over traditional open cut excavation methods due to the depth of the project and will reduce the impact to residents along Standford Ave.
